Summary
Luan Teylo is a tenured researcher and Ph.D. in Computer Science with nine years of experience focused on I/O, distributed algorithms, scheduling, and fault tolerance for cloud and HPC systems. After a doctoral exchange at Sorbonne Université where he worked on scheduling and resilience in cloud environments, he joined Inria Bordeaux as a postdoc and progressed to a tenured researcher role with the TaDaaM team. His recent work since 2022 emphasizes I/O performance and scalability in HPC, bridging theoretical distributed-algorithm insights with practical system-level optimizations. Comfortable teaching and mentoring from prior tutoring roles, he pairs deep academic rigor with hands-on system design and evaluation. Based in Bordeaux, he brings a global research background and a pragmatic focus on making distributed I/O more reliable and efficient.
